How to Make Body Butter
I absolutely LOVE the consistency of this DIY whipped body butter. It’s like slathering your body with clouds! Beating air into the mixture at various intervals creates tiny air pockets, giving it an exceptionally light and almost marshmallow-like consistency. It’s a lot like whisking up some whipped cream for sweet desserts!

Don’t Be fooled By Simplicity, Lard Soap Is A Great Gift!
Lard soap is back and better than ever, thanks to these three amazing recipes! Lard is a great because it’s a super cheap ingredient to work with. But that’s not to say that a lard soap isn’t any good. On the contrary! Lard makes a lovely pure white soap that produces large soapy bubbles. And if you learn how to make your lard soaps interesting, they can actually look and feel much more luxurious than you might think.

Coconut Milk Soap Recipe With Lime & Coconut Oil
Making cold process soap is a lot of fun, especially the part where you can experiment with different ingredients. But have you experimented with using coconut milk instead of water before? This coconut milk soap recipe is exactly that, walking you through the different steps needed to use milk instead of water. As this is a coconut soap recipe, it also includes a fair amount of coconut oil and makes an absolutely fantastic soap that I just adore.
